Everything you need to know about gravel delivery in Cave Junction.
Customers in Cave Junction typically order a mix of gravel, sand, dirt, and stone for driveways, pads, landscaping, and drainage projects. Both homeowners and contractors often buy the same material types but in different quantities; homeowners usually order smaller loads while contractors buy bulk tons for larger jobs. Local geology can change texture and color, so expect regional variation in appearance.
Start by matching the material size and shape to the job: compactable, angular materials work better for driveways while coarser, free-draining mixes suit drainage and erosion control. Consider traffic, slope, and maintenance needs—higher traffic areas need more durable, compactable material. Cave Junction's West Oregon climate has wet winters and drier summers, so materials that compact well and drain effectively perform best for year-round durability. Fine materials can wash or rut during heavy rains, while coarser mixes help with runoff and frost action. Expect material behavior to vary with local soils and slopes, and plan grading and drainage accordingly.

Contractors weigh upfront material cost against life-cycle performance: lower-cost fines may save money initially but require more maintenance, while coarser, well-graded mixes cost more but last longer with less upkeep. Durability needs depend on traffic load and site drainage; contractors commonly choose materials that compact well and shed water to reduce maintenance. Ask for contractor-level recommendations if you need help balancing cost and longevity for a particular site.
Use a combination of properly sized, free-draining aggregates and surface shaping (swales, slopes) to move water away from structures and reduce erosion. Incorporate filter fabric, riprap or larger stone in concentrated flow areas and consider vegetative solutions on slopes to stabilize soil. Because local rainfall and soils affect performance, size materials and drainage features conservatively and consult local professionals for steeper or high-runoff sites.
